  • Project mention: LCD, Please – de-make of “Papers, please”, celebrating 10 years since launch | news.ycombinator.com | 2023-08-09

    >Oh, you can also allow canvas fingerprinting, but that seems like a bad idea - maybe in a separate firefox profile just for sites like this one..

    No it won't help. That is big problem with finger printing. It basically logs your computer hardward with the profile.

    So no matter how many times you make new profiles. This can be mitigated via VM. However with bugs such as zenbleed, VM may not be enough.

    Nothing is private has a good demo. https://github.com/gautamkrishnar/nothing-private
